PVH Corp. Senior Financial Analyst in New York, New York

Design Your Future at PVH

Senior Financial Analyst

The Sr Financial Analyst – Americas FP&A:

  • The Sr Financial Analyst will support the Sr Director FP&A and will act as a financial advisor and business partner to the business stakeholders by providing insights to enable and drive fact-based, optimal decision-making, and input in the development of the business strategies and operations of the Americas business.

  • Operationalize work within NA regional teams to coordinate and streamline processes and procedures and secure smooth consolidation of NA figures for reporting purposes.

P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ES/ACCOUNTABILITIES OF THE JOB:

Overall Strategic, Tactical & Operational Planning & Tracking:

  • Driving the overall financial analysis, planning and control of the NA Overhead costs including W&D/Logistics, TPG (IT) and other support functions (e.g. HR, Finance and Legal).

  • Drive, challenge and monitor expenses, challenging the status quo and work closely with the Sr Director FP&A in providing periodic reports enabling Senior Management to make more agile resources allocation decisions.

  • Support in providing monthly reporting and communication for the Senior Management Group (including actual results, estimates and budget variances).

  • Lead together with the Sr Director FP&A cost control meetings based on actuals/estimate/budget with the department leaders in the COO organization.

  • Support with weekly R&O process.

  • Support in preparation of the annual budget and three-year plan presentations.

  • Ad hoc requests to support the business.

Financial Reporting & Compliance:

  • Responsible for month-end, quarter-end and year-end financial closings for respective costs in NA overhead; opex and capex planning and control

  • Drive consolidation of NA figures in several weekly/monthly reports

  • Review, approve and track invoices related to the NA overhead costs.

  • Support in development, implementation and monitoring of policies and procedures to ensure accurate and timely recording and reporting of operating results.

  • Ensure the integrity of financial policies and financial statements.

  • Drive automation and efficiency in FP&A processes through dashboards and automated reports.

QUALIFICATIONS & EXPERIENCE:

Experience:

5 years prior accounting/finance experience, preferably in the

apparel industry or consumer products

Education:

Bachelor’s degree in Business Finance or Accounting required.

Skills:

  • Excellent analytical skills, managing large data quantities from multiple sources.

  • Ability to work in a structured way, communicate clearly and build relationships with different stakeholders within the organization.

  • Proficiency in Microsoft package software programs

  • Knowledge of SAP financial packages (general ledger)

  • Knowledge of Essbase software (financial reporting)

  • Knowledge of ACS software and JDA
